This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Utah.

📋 Description

• Meeting sales and utilization targets in the designated territory.

• Responsible for executing effective territory penetration, coverage, and account identification to boost sales and expand the customer base for the Company’s consumables.

• Delivering training, presentations, and product demonstrations to customers, utilizing effective communication and sales techniques.

• Informing customers about the indications, contraindications, and safety of Company products, and demonstrating how they meet customer needs.

• Assisting customers with marketing strategies, which include but are not limited to website and microsite development, internal office branding, patient segmentation, and external marketing strategies.

• Supporting and facilitating the organization of regional training workshops and trade shows within the territory.

• Planning sales calls and managing time efficiently to maximize customer contact and deliver top-notch customer service.

• Completing administrative duties including periodic business plans, weekly expense reports, maintaining up-to-date territory account profiles, and managing the customer database.

• Overseeing daily sales administration activities in a detailed and timely manner, such as updates and data entry in Salesforce.com.

• Keeping informed about the industry and competitive products.

• Building and nurturing supportive, productive, and effective relationships at all organizational levels.

• Engaging in industry-related trade shows and meetings.

• Adhering to all relevant quality and regulatory guidelines as a core part of business operations.

• Maintaining consistent communication with the Regional Practice Manager and Area Sales Manager regarding all territory and regional matters, including accurate forecasting.

• Exhibiting a strong work ethic while representing the Company with integrity, ethics, honesty, loyalty, and professionalism at all times.


⛳️ Requirements

• A Bachelor’s degree in health, sciences, pharmacy, or a business-related field is preferred, or relevant and equivalent industry experience is required.

• 2-4 years of proven success in selling medical products or services to physicians and/or other healthcare providers is preferred.

• Direct customer engagement with the plastic surgery and dermatology sectors is preferred.

• Experience in selling consumables is preferred.

• Strong oral and written communication skills to effectively engage with all employee levels.

• Demonstrated ability to provide exceptional customer service and support for the integration of the CoolSculpting Procedure, ensuring high levels of customer and patient satisfaction.

• High accountability, reliability, and responsiveness are essential.

• Capable of delivering effective and persuasive communications and technical presentations to physicians, management, and/or large audiences.

• Ability to thoroughly understand and articulate the attributes and qualities of Company products using professional selling and closing techniques.

• A positive attitude and passion for working in the aesthetic field.

• Competency in using word processing and database applications, as well as various software programs like Excel and PowerPoint.

• Strong organizational skills for schedule management and follow-up are necessary.

• Familiarity with FDA GMPs is required.

• Ability to operate in a controlled environment regulated by FDA GMPs.

• Required to have a home office setup with reliable high-speed internet access.

• Willingness to travel to adequately cover the region, which may include multiple overnight stays, attending trade shows, and participating in corporate and training meetings.

• A valid driver’s license issued by the state/province of residence and a clean driving record are required.
